Merciless attacks:
The attacks were carried out mainly by members of the terrorist group Islamic State in the Greater Sahara (ISGS), which operates in the Sahel region. These fighters intensified their activities in the three border area (Niger-Mali-Burkina Faso) after the withdrawal of the French Barkhane force. Nigerien soldiers were ambushed while coming to the aid of national guardsmen trapped by terrorists. This tragedy demonstrates the determination of terrorist groups to sow chaos and destruction in the region.
A dramatic assessment:
Nigerien authorities initially reported 29 deaths, but information provided by security and civilian sources shows a much higher toll. According to these sources, the number of victims is around 60, not including the missing soldiers. The soldiers’ funerals took place in Tillia prefecture, where bereaved families paid their last respects to their fallen loved ones. Sadness and indignation invaded the country, which declared a three-day national mourning.
